HELP PLEASE ! Factor the polynomial completely. 18x^2y-2y

Answer:

2y( 3x-1)(3x+1)

Step-by-step explanation:

18x^2y-2y

Factor out the greatest common factor 2y

2y( 9x^2 -1)

The term in the parentheses is the difference of squares

a^2 - b^2 = (a-b)(a+b)

2y( 3x-1)(3x+1)
